KANSAS CITY, MO. — Northern Michigan University is once again the lone Great Lakes Intercollegiate Athletic Conference (GLIAC) program ranked inside the National Soccer Coaches Association of America (NSCAA) national men's soccer poll after three weeks of competition. NMU is positioned No. 21 in the country after the Wildcats went 1-0-1 last week, including a scoreless draw against Parkside who leads the GLIAC.

Northern Michigan (4-1-1, 2-0-1 GLIAC) will head to Ashland and Saginaw Valley this weekend in hopes of moving to 6-1-1 on the year.
